八位串行可控加减法器与八位可控加减法器有什么区别
时间: 2023-07-31 12:09:55 浏览: 49
八位串行可控加减法器和八位可控加减法器都是数字电路中的加减法器,它们的主要区别在于数据输入方式和加减运算方式。
八位串行可控加减法器的数据输入方式是串行输入,即每次只能输入一位二进制数,需要进行多次输入才能完成八位数的加减运算。而八位可控加减法器的数据输入方式是并行输入,即一次性输入八位二进制数,可以直接进行加减运算。
此外,八位串行可控加减法器的加减运算方式是逐位运算,即每次只能对一位进行加减运算,需要进行多次运算才能完成八位数的加减运算。而八位可控加减法器的加减运算方式是同时进行八位的加减运算,速度更快。
因此,八位串行可控加减法器和八位可控加减法器的应用场景不同。八位串行可控加减法器适用于数据量较小,对速度要求不高的场景,而八位可控加减法器适用于数据量较大,对速度要求较高的场景。
相关问题
假设所有门电路延迟均为t,8位串行可控加减法器的时间延迟是18t为什么?(2)有符
根据题目中给出的条件,假设所有门电路延迟均为t,8位串行可控加减法器的时间延迟是18t。这是因为在串行可控加减法器中,每个位的计算都需要通过一系列的门电路来完成,而这些门电路的延迟都为t。因为是串行计算,所以每一位的计算都需要等待上一位计算完成后才能进行,所以整个加减法器的延迟时间就是每一位计算的延迟时间的累加。
另外,这个加减法器是有符号的,所以在进行减法运算时,可能还需要进行补码和溢出等额外的计算,这些额外的计算也会增加时间延迟。因此,8位串行可控加减法器的时间延迟是18t。
综上所述,串行可控加减法器的时间延迟是由每一位计算的延迟时间累加得到的,同时还要考虑到有符号运算可能需要的额外计算,因此总的时间延迟为18t。
运算器设计——8位可控加减法电路设计实验结论
位可控加减法器的设计思路是输入两个8位数,选通端Sub为0时做加法,为1时做减法,检测运算结果是否溢出后再进行输出。在logisim中打开“运算器实验3.circ”文件,找到“☆8位可控加减法器”子电路,完成8位可控加减法器的设计,并仿真验证设计的正确性。在验证过程中,我们可以输入不同的加数和减数,检查输出结果是否正确。如果结果正确,则说明设计是正确的。
快速加法器的设计思路是输入两个8位数,检测结果是否溢出后再进行输出。在logisim中打开“运算器实验3.circ”文件,在对应电路中完成8位串行加法器电路的设计,并仿真验证设计的正确性。在验证过程中,我们可以输入不同的加数和被加数,检查输出结果是否正确。如果结果正确,则说明设计是正确的。